Debt settlement has swiftly become the most popular debt reduction approach in America today. Through the right Debt Relief Organization, you will become debt free in 5-24 months, for about 15-60% of your total debt.

With good things like these, you should possibly consider going for a Debt Consolidation Company. However, very similar to the real estate field, way too many companies are jumping in the field and giving the industry a bad wrap.

Be leery of anyone that wants to provide you a "quote" for a Arizona Debt Management Service without taking a close look at all of your current account statements. To have the ability to accurately estimate and structure a Arizona Debt Consolidation Service that you can actually complete successfully all of the following factors should be considered:

Who your collectors are.
The number of creditors you have.
How far behind are you.
Account activity such as balance transfers, cash advances and large purchase.
Your state of residence.
Your financial condition.

Without looking at your current financial circumstances, there's really no way to determine how long it can take or how much you can settle what you owe for, it is sort of like a loan officer giving a quote on a any kind of loan without first considering how much your debt is or how much your income is.

This should make you realize something about the company and stay away from them.

Make Sure You Ask These Questions Before You select a Arizona Debt Management Business

Does the Organization have an "A" rating with the Better Business Bureau?

You Should check with the BBB the rating of a Debt Assistance Business before you employ them. Don't just take the organization's word for it. Telephone the BBB and ask about the service.

What Does the Service Cost and When is the Compensation Collected?

Most Debt Consolidation Companies take 13% to 16% of your debt as a fee for their program. This payment is calculated on your debt you have when you enroll in the program and is received in advance. With the organization's upfront compensation coming out in the first 9 to 14 months, most of what you pay into their service is taken by them as compensation.

In a legitament Debt Consolidation plan you only are charged a small admission fee to go onto the program, so what you put into the plan is actually held in reserve and not taken in compensation. The settlement fee is calculated on the amount forgiven by your creditors. This means the fees is calculatedon the amount the Service saves you. The Organization should only collect a settlement fee once a settlement has been reached. This makes it possible for you to get out of debt much faster and gives the Organization compulsion to get the job done!

Does the Arizona Debt Relief Program offer Debt and Credit Counseling?

Most Arizona Debt Assistance Companies offer only debt settlement. A bona fide Debt Assistance Organization will provide Credit and Debt counseling as well as Debt Consolidation and Debt Settlement Services. Your credit counselor should help you consider all your options so you can pick which program is the right one for your situation and budget. The Business should not encourage one service but should help you in picking the right program for you.

How Long has the Arizona Debt Consolidation Businesses Been in the Debt Reduction Business?

If it is a start up or brand new in the business, the Organization will have little experience. You Should Always beware of a Business that will not provide proof of their experience.

Can the Arizona Arizona Debt Settlement Organizations Stop the Collectors From Contacting Me?

No Arizona Debt Settlement Company can promise they will end all collector calls. That is simply not possible. Anyone who claims they can is not being honest.

Will The Arizona Debt Management Companies be making monthly payments to the Collection Agencies?

The Creditors are not paid until a mutually agreeable settlement is negotiated and agreed to. Therefore, Debt Negotiation Organizations do not make monthly payments to the collection agencies. That is simply how the service works. Any Debt Negotiation Business telling you otherwise is not being truthful.

Can I get sued?

A creditor can sue you anytime you are late on your payments. If you are told anything else, a red flag has just been raised. The debt Assistance Organization is not being truthful

Will This Ruin my Credit Report?

Contrary to what some people think or believe, all debt negotiation plans will ruin your credit score. Think about it you are in debt and are not paying as agreed. The debt relief program is meant only as a management tool. However when your debt has been forgiven, all of your accounts will show a $0 balance and you are ready to begin the process of rebuilding your credit score.

When Will I Get My First Negotiation?

While this varies in every case, your first negotiation needs to be made within the first 12 months from the inception of your plan. More than 12 months is unreasonable and the Organization that tells you this is not the greatest company to do business with.

Where is the Funds Held While You're Awaiting a Negotiation?

This is a very good question. Your funds should be kept at a third party escrow Business that is FDIC insured. Any Business informing you to save your own money or to send the funds to them is probably not the greatest company. If you need to settle your debt, you need to have the money available to pay the credit card companies when the settlement is reached.

These questions are suggestions. The main point is to ask many questions and get the answers to those questions. With your questions answered, you can find the Debt Management Service that is best for you.
